Harry Lorayne's Apocalypse – Volumes 1–5
The complete first five volumes of the legendary magazine Apocalypse (1978–1982) in one luxury hardcover.
Apocalypse is considered one of the most important publications in the history of close-up magic. Edited by Harry Lorayne, it published monthly routines, techniques, and ideas from the greatest names in magic. This collected volume brings together the complete first five volumes and contains a wealth of professional material for the serious magician. ( Vanishing Inc. Magic )
With over 720 pages and extensive indexes, this book offers:
More than 250 map effects
More than 140 coin effects
Dozens of effects with everyday objects
Essays, tips, and professional insights from Harry Lorayne
Extensive indexes by effect, technique, and author ( 7magicstore.com )
You will find contributions from an impressive list of greats, including:
Dai Vernon
David Roth
Paul Harris
Derek Dingle
Brother John Hamman
Ken Krenzel
Slydini
Frank Garcia
Max Maven
Larry Jennings
Richard Kaufman
and many others. ( 7magicstore.com )
